Pre-Dive Briefing and Practice

Before heading into the water, your certified instructor provides a thorough briefing. This covers essential skills like mask clearing, regulator use, hand signals, and safety protocols—crucial elements for a comfortable experience.

For first-timers, the option to practice in a pool or water with pool-like conditions is a real boon. It allows you to get comfortable with the gear and breathing techniques in a controlled environment, reducing anxiety and building confidence.

Dive Sites: Liberty Wreck & Coral Garden

The tour offers two main dive site options, each with its unique appeal:

  • Liberty Wreck: This World War II shipwreck has become an artificial reef teeming with marine life. It’s a favorite among beginners because of its relatively shallow depth, allowing for easy exploration. What to Expect During the Dives

The first dive mainly focuses on familiarization—getting comfortable with your gear and breathing underwater. Since the instructors accompany each diver closely, you’re supported throughout. A second dive is highly recommended, allowing you to truly relax and enjoy the experience, rather than just getting accustomed to the equipment.
